Artwork Description

A mixed media drawing of a woman drinking spirit, with swallows flying around her, from Sydney artist Leni Kae.

”The woman in this image has a fierce look of knowing. She drinks (metaphorical) spirit - representing drinking her truth. She knows who she is and what she wants. As an animal spirit, the swallow is a messenger between worlds. In this painting they fly away from her because she no longer requires their help. She holds her own in this moment- the now”. - Leni Kae | @LeniKae on Instagram

A beautiful piece for art lovers and to start your art collection.
This artwork is part of Leni Kae's series "Animal Spirit".

Pencil, Graphite, charcoal, watercolour, ink on A3 paper

Artist Bio

Leni Kae is a Sydney-based Australian artist and author whose work explores the relationship between nature, symbolism, perception, and inner awareness.
Her work spans expressive bird and Animal Spirit paintings, abstract landscape art, Greek mythology inspired art and contemporary symbolic works created through layered acrylic, watercolour, ink, and mixed media. Using fluid movement, luminous colour, and intuitive mark-making, her paintings investigate themes of awareness, connection, atmosphere, and inner experience.
Alongside her studio practice, Leni also creates books and immersive creative works that bridge visual art, storytelling, and reflection.

Leni Kae’s work has been a finalist in numerous Australian art prizes, including Du Reitz Art Awads 2025, Lake Art Prize 2022, Heysen Prize for Landscape 2020, Mandorla Art Awards 2020,
